AMC 10 Competition Introduction
The AMC 10 (American Mathematics Competition 10) is organized by the Mathematical Association of America (MAA). Each year, over 300,000 middle and high school students worldwide participate. It is highly recognized by top 30 universities in the UK and the US as a key indicator of STEM proficiency.
- Eligibility: Open to students in grade 10 and below, under 17.5 years of age. It is highly suitable for international students in grades 7–10.
- Exam Format: The competition offers two versions, A and B, which are identical in difficulty. Students may take one or both, with the highest score used for advancement. The test consists of 25 multiple-choice questions to be completed in 75 minutes, with a maximum score of 150. Scoring: +6 points for a correct answer, +1.5 points for an unanswered question, and 0 points for an incorrect answer (no penalty for wrong answers).
- Content Covered: The exam focuses on four core modules: Algebra, Geometry, Number Theory, and Combinatorics & Probability. The content aligns with IGCSE, A-Level, and AP curricula but excludes calculus. It heavily emphasizes mathematical thinking and problem-solving skills.
- Core Value: The top 5% of scorers receive the Honor Roll (HR) award, while the top 2.5% qualify for the AIME (American Invitational Mathematics Examination). These achievements are significant references for admissions to elite universities like MIT, Stanford, Oxford, and Cambridge, and serve as a strong advantage for STEM major applications.
2026 AMC 10 Registration & Exam Schedule
- Registration Opens: Registration for the A version is expected to open in late September 2026, while the B version will likely open in mid-to-late October 2026.
- Registration Deadlines:
- A Version: Expected around October 27, 2026.
- B Version: Expected around November 9, 2026.
- Exam Dates (2026):
- A Version: Estimated November 5, 2026, 17:00–18:15 (75 minutes, in-person).
- B Version: Estimated November 13, 2026, 17:00–18:15 (scheduled one week after the A version).
- Results Release: Scores will be published 6–8 weeks after the exam. Students can check their results and download electronic certificates through their registration channels.

AMC 10 Difficulty Analysis & Preparation Strategies
How does the AMC 10 compare to domestic math competitions? Its difficulty is comparable to the provincial level of China’s junior high school math league and significantly exceeds standard international school mathematics. The core challenges lie in three areas:
- Out-of-Syllabus Knowledge: Topics in Number Theory and Combinatorics (e.g., modular arithmetic, inclusion-exclusion principle) are often weak points in standard international curricula and require systematic, targeted study.
- Steep Difficulty Curve: The 25 questions are clearly tiered. Questions 1–10 are foundational (target 90%+ accuracy), Questions 11–20 are intermediate (the core scoring zone), and Questions 21–25 are advanced (these determine award levels).
- Difference in Mathematical Thinking: While school math often relies on fixed formulas and routines, the AMC 10 emphasizes reverse analysis, rapid problem-solving, and finding optimal solution paths. Completing 25 questions in 75 minutes demands both speed and accuracy.
To prepare efficiently, follow a three-phase “Foundation – Intensive – Sprint” strategy:
- Foundation Phase (June–July): Complete the knowledge framework by reviewing core algebra and geometry concepts. Focus on bridging gaps in number theory and combinatorics. Goal: Achieve 90%+ accuracy on questions 1–15 and establish a complete conceptual framework.
- Intensive Phase (August–September): Break through past papers by practicing the last 10 years of exams. Conduct module-specific training for intermediate questions (11–20) and summarize high-frequency problem-solving techniques. Goal: Reach 85%+ accuracy on intermediate questions and begin familiarizing yourself with advanced problem-solving approaches.
- Sprint Phase (October–November): Focus on mock exams and pacing. Take 2–3 full-length, timed mock exams per week (strictly 75 minutes) to build exam rhythm. Identify and fix weak points. Goal: Score 105+ (the typical AIME qualification cutoff).
